Caduceus is a symbol of Hermes or Mercury in Greek and Roman mythology. The Caduceus symbol is identified with thieves, merchants, and messengers. All of these wines are inspired by Mythical Ancient Gods. Made by international wine varieties, each wine correlates with a well known wine region around the world. Maynard, aims to make his wines as food friendly as possible, so their finesse may surprise you.
Merkin Vineyards 2021 Chupacabra- Willcox, Arizona $46.95
The Chupacabra is a creature with its origins in the Americas, allegedly first sighted in Puerto Rico. The Merkin Vineyards wines can be seen as entry level Maynard wines. This red blend is always a shapeshifting blend of various red grapes from Willcox. The 2021 vintage is 35% Grenache, 35% Syrah, 30% Mourvèdre. Warming spice notes, leather, violets and baked red fruit dominate this wine.
Caduceus 2018 Nagual de la Naga- Yavapai County, Arizona- $84.95
Naga is a mythical creature from South East Asian tradition, rooted in Hinduism and Buddhism. It is half man and half serpent. This wine hails from their Eliphante Block, which is planted with Italian varieties. This vintage is predominantly Sangiovese with small amounts of Aglianico and Negroamaro. This elegant, food friendly wine would go great with your meat rich pastas.
Caduceus 2017 Sancha- Yavapai County, Arizona- $91.95
From English Folklore, Sancha was married to a count that she had to rescue a few times. The most notable rescue was when she swapped places with him in prison by wearing his clothes. This wine is Maynard’s version of Ribera del Duero. Made with 100% Tempranillo, aged for 18 months in French oak barrels. Expect notes of dried red fruits, tobacco, spice and leather.
Caduceus 2018 Primer Paso- Yavapai County, Arizona- $82.95
This is their take on a Côte Rotie from the Rhone Valley in France. Classically these wines must be Syrah dominated with some small amounts of Viognier allowed as a way to increase aromatics and freshness. This take from Arizona, is mostly Syrah, with a small amount of Petite Syrah and an even smaller amount of Malvasia. This silky wine will have notes of purple and blue fruit, pepper and black olives
Caduceus 2019 Kitsune- Willcox, Arizona- $87.95
From Japanese Folklore, Kitsune are fox-like creatures with paranormal powers that increase with age. Similarly, you could hold on to this wine for a couple years longer to see its development. This wine is fully made up of Sangiovese. It is Maynard’s take on Chianti. Notes of cherries, tobacco and tomato leaf.
Caduceus 2019 Anubis- Yavapai County, Arizona- $84.95
Anubis is the Egyptian God of the underworld and death. This full bodied red wine is considered to be the beefiest of all of their wines. This is a blend of Cabernet Sauvignon, Cabernet Franc and Aglianico. Meant to be most like a Meritage Blend, or a Bordeaux Blend outside of Bordeaux, with the addition of Italian Aglianico. This wine has notes of green tobacco, plum, red fruit leather and baking spice. Enjoy your heartiest meal on a cold day.
